Unintended build execution via GET-enabled rebuild endpoint
Published Jul 12, 2023 · Updated Nov 6, 2024
Cross-site request forgery in Jenkins Rebuilder Plugin 320.v5a_0933a_e7d61 and earlier allows remote attackers to rebuild a previous build. A rebuild HTTP endpoint accepts a state-changing request without requiring POST, allowing a victim's authenticated browser request to start the prior build again. Exploitation requires user interaction and a session authorized to rebuild the targeted job; the bounded consequence is an unintended build execution.
